Tavern Watch Plays See You Space Cowboy, episode 2: Hot dog pratfalls and Cybertruck demolition
Hot on the trail of some scumbag NFT and crypto traders (aka their latest bounty targets), the Tavern Watch team lays an ambush for their bounty in this week’s episode of See You Space Cowboy on our TTRPG actual play podcast. What follows is one of the most chaotic fight sequences we’ve ever had; shots are fired, a few people get knitting needled, there’s a mishap with a hot dog, and it all ends with Jen riding on top of the same Cybertruck she’s demolishing — and that’s not even including following these chumps back to their home base.
Joe Perez as our GM somehow manages to direct all this chaos in a cohesive direction; meanwhile, the rest of us doing our best to cause trouble are:
- Trish Olson as Kit Brooksfield, who’s all brains, a little cool, and maybe some kind of hacker (but for all the right reasons!)
- Chris Chesno as Colt Sterling, a hard-smoking, hard-bitten hot dog and gunplay enthusiast
- Joan Albright as Veronia Graves, a former housewife whose bad run-in with the law now has her on a mission
- Liz Harper as Jen, who is definitely not the crew’s kleptomaniac
- Phil Ulrich as Luke Navarro, a brick wall of a man who’s ostensibly the ship’s captain but mostly the team dad
This is the second in a three-part actual play series of See You Space Cowboy; the first part is here, and new episodes come out every Monday!
